David Williamson Presents A Wealth Of Facts And Anecdotes Of Every Monarch In England From Celtic Times To The Present Day. His Text Is Enlivened By A Rich Selection Of Images Chosen Primarily From The The Collections Of The National Portrait Gallery Of London.
